Precautions
On safety
* Operate the unit only on 120 V AC, 60 Hz.
¢ Should any solid object or Iiquid fall into the cabinet,
unplug the unit and have It checked by qualified
personnel before operating it any further.
¢ Unplug the unit from the wall outlet if it is not to be
used for an extended period of time. To disconnect the
cord, pull It out by grasping the plug. Never pull the
cord itself.

» Place the unit on a level surface.
* Do not install the unit near heat sources such as
radiators or air ducts, or in a place subject to direct
sunlight, excessive dust, mechanical vibration or shock.
* Good ventilation is essential to prevent intemal heat
build-up in the unit. Place the unit in a location with
adequate alr circulation. Do not place the unit on a soft
surface.
